Re: WiFi to Ethernet Bridge
No, we can not. It's impossible to bridge encrypted WiFi to someone and at the same time use the same WiFi on bridged host. Hardware WiFi bridge - real bridge - does not use WiFi by itself, only redirects. I know two workarounds. 1. Routing. It can be done, but YOU should understand what you're doin...

Re: Board alternative
Is there an alternative? Does WTware support boards like banana pi or libre computer ? No. Raspberry is the only ARM manufacturer that develops linux kernel for their boards. We tried Rockchip boards before Raspberry. Ancient, unsupported kernels with terrible code quality. Never again, until some ...
